    2-4-1 AP Mode This i s the most commo n mode. Wh en in AP mo de, this access p oint acts as a bridge between 802.11b /g/Dra ft-N wirel ess devices an d wired Ethern et network, and exchange data between th em.     2-4-3 Universal Repeater In this mode, th e acces s point can act as a wir eless repeate r; it can be S tation an d AP at the same ti me. It can use Stati on functi on to connect to a R oot AP and use AP functi on to service al l wireless sta tions wi thin its coverage.     2-5 Wireless Sec urity This wi reless access poi nt provides m any types of wi reless securi ty (wirel ess data encrypti on). When you use data enc ryption, da ta transferred by radio si gnals in th e air will become u nreadable for those peopl e who don’t know correct encrypt ion key (encrypti on password).     2-5-4 WPA RADIUS WPA Radi us is the combi nation of WPA encryption method and RAD IUS user authenti cation. If you h ave a RADIUS au thenti cation server, you can check th e identi fy of every wi reless cli ent by user databas e.
